Thanks Mark. I'm the one looking for the lyrics. The Tyneside Tattooist is a monologue I heard once at a folk club in the UK. It was presented by one of the High-Level Ranters as I recall. It tells the story of a tattooist who completely covers a woman in his fine art. He wants to marry her but she instead marries a club owner and becomes a stripper! The last line of the monologue goes: "...but all the blokes that admire her, know the work was done by me, 'cos I signed it, 'cross her bottom, wi' me name!"
